25
26 static inline unsigned int
27 ip_vs_lc_dest_overhead(struct ip_vs_dest *dest)
28 {
29         /*
30          * We think the overhead of processing active connections is 256
31          * times higher than that of inactive connections in average. (This
32          * 256 times might not be accurate, we will change it later) We
33          * use the following formula to estimate the overhead now:
34          *                dest->activeconns*256 + dest->inactconns
35          */
36         return (atomic_read(&dest->activeconns) << 8) +
37                 atomic_read(&dest->inactconns);
38 }
39
40
41 /*
42  *      Least Connection scheduling
43  */
44 static struct ip_vs_dest *
45 ip_vs_lc_schedule(struct ip_vs_service *svc, const struct sk_buff *skb)
46 {
47         struct ip_vs_dest *dest, *least = NULL;
48         unsigned int loh = 0, doh;
49
50         IP_VS_DBG(6, "%s(): Scheduling...\n", __func__);
51
52         /*
53          * Simply select the server with the least number of
54          *        (activeconns<<5) + inactconns
55          * Except whose weight is equal to zero.
56          * If the weight is equal to zero, it means that the server is
57          * quiesced, the existing connections to the server still get
58          * served, but no new connection is assigned to the server.
59          */
60
61         list_for_each_entry(dest, &svc->destinations, n_list) {
62                 if ((dest->flags & IP_VS_DEST_F_OVERLOAD) ||
63                     atomic_read(&dest->weight) == 0)
64                         continue;
65                 doh = ip_vs_lc_dest_overhead(dest);
66                 if (!least || doh < loh) {
67                         least = dest;
68                         loh = doh;
69                 }
70         }
71
72         if (!least)
73                 IP_VS_ERR_RL("LC: no destination available\n");
74         else
75                 IP_VS_DBG_BUF(6, "LC: server %s:%u activeconns %d "
76                               "inactconns %d\n",
77                               IP_VS_DBG_ADDR(svc->af, &least->addr),
78                               ntohs(least->port),
79                               atomic_read(&least->activeconns),
80                               atomic_read(&least->inactconns));
81
82         return least;
83 }
